Collector context

# Kakarot Collector Note Kakarot represents Goku's birth name and holds thematic significance for Dragon Ball Super collectors building Saiyan-focused decks. As an R-rarity card from the Saiyan's Pride booster set, it occupies a middle ground in the collecting hierarchy—accessible enough for casual players but relevant for serious deck construction. Collectors typically view this card through a functional lens rather than as a chase piece, valuing it primarily for gameplay applications rather than scarcity. The standard variant status means there's no chase element from alternate art or special treatments. For those assembling comprehensive Saiyan lineups or completing set collections, Kakarot serves as a straightforward inclusion rather than a standout acquisition.
